The legitimate method to acquire a Czech driving license involves a number of steps, which can vary based on whether the candidate holds a driving license from another nation or is a newbie driver. Here's a comprehensive breakdown:

Step-by-Step Process

  1. House Verification
    Make sure that you have legal residency in the Czech Republic.
  2. Driver Training Course
    Register in a qualified driving school. The duration varies however generally includes both theoretical and useful lessons.
  3. Theory Examination
    Pass a written test covering traffic guidelines, road signs, and safety policies.
  4. Practical Examination
    Show driving abilities in an arranged roadway test.
  5. Send Application
    After passing both tests, send an application for the driving license at the local authority (Czech Office of Transport).
  6. Receive License
    When authorized, you will receive your driving license.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Can I exchange my foreign driving license for a Czech one?

Yes, foreigners can exchange their legitimate foreign driving licenses for a Czech driving license, offered their home nation has a reciprocal arrangement with the Czech Republic.

2. The length of time is a Czech driving license legitimate?

Normally, a Czech driving license is valid for ten years for categories A and B and 5 years for categories C, D, and E.

3. Is it possible to drive with an international driving license (IDP) in the Czech Republic?

Yes, an IDP is valid in the Czech Republic for approximately 90 days, after which a local driving license or a legitimate foreign license is required.

4. What documents do I require to request a driving license?

Candidates require to offer proof of residency, a medical certificate, pictures, evidence of passing both theory and useful tests, and a completed application type.
